Transaction 5856da82b822e255d9552341653c652b17b67db378014333e78ca365db588991
1 Input
1 Output
-
5856da82b822e255d9552341653c652b17b67db378014333e78ca365db588991:0
- value
- 9796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59f2f678a9dca929d840b8d9f413d84ac5006215 OP_EQUAL
- address
- 39td7y1UHEUhrg9nB51SLv36wLuFwYtPhF